Anne W Paré, Certified Orthotist, has been employed by Surestep as a Clinical Researcher & Educator since 2014. Anne graduated from University of Texas Southwestern Allied Health Sciences School in 1993; then completed a pediatric internship at Texas Scottish Rite Hospital in Dallas in 1994. She worked as a staff orthotist at The Institute for Rehabilitation and Research (TIRR) in Houston, Texas before opening Hope Orthotics, Inc. For over 30 years, Anne has specialized in pediatrics, spinal cord, and brain injury. Anne’s current clinical focus is tracking outcomes in children using Surestep products, the development of new products and creating and presenting educational courses for physical and occupational therapists and orthotists for Surestep.
